About this opportunity
As a Support Worker, you will deliver a variety of services to participants to support them to live a fulfilling and meaningful life in the community. Your working day may include assistance and or support with daily life, including personal care, domestic activities, social and community participation and varying skill development activities, social and community participation and varying skill development activities.

Pre employment checks
- Minimum Certificate 3 in Mental Health, Disability, Aged Care, Home and Community Care or related fields (Desired, but not essential)
- Applicants having experience and knowledge in psychosocial disability will be at an advantage
- A current valid Driver's License and a registered, insured vehicle
- National Police Check (completed within the last 12 months) and Working with Children Check
- NDIS Orientation Certificate - free online course
- NDIS Worker Screening Check
- Manual Handling training would be desired
